以下哪个python函数名是错误
其他 180
-
根据标题生成答案。
2年前 -
抱歉,能否提供更具体的选项或上下文,以便我能为您提供准确的答案?
2年前 -
根据标题回答问题
在Python中,函数名可以是任何有效的标识符,但必须遵循一定的命名规则。函数名应该以字母或下划线开头,并且只能包含字母、数字和下划线。另外,函数名是区分大小写的。因此,以下都是有效的函数名:
1. my_function
2. calculate_sum
3. print_hello
4. _private_function
5. get_value然而,有以下情况则会导致函数名错误:
1. 以数字开头的函数名,例如:
1_function2. 函数名包含特殊字符,例如:
hello-world3. 函数名与Python的关键字冲突,例如:
def4. 函数名已经被其他变量或函数占用,例如:
print5. 函数名太长或不具有描述性,不符合Python的命名约定,例如:
this_is_a_very_long_and_not_descriptive_function_name总结:
在Python中,函数名必须遵循特定的命名规则,不能包含特殊字符,不能与关键字冲突,也不能与其他变量或函数冲突。一个好的函数名应该是有意义的、简单易懂的,并且能够清晰地描述函数的功能。2年前